Jean Elsen sale 156, lot 1266

This specimen was lot 1266 in Jean Elsen sale 156 (Brussels, September 2023), where it sold for €220 (about US$282 including buyer's fees). The catalog description[1] noted,

"BELGIQUE, Royaume, Léopold Ier (1831-1865), Cu 2 centimes, 1845. BRAEMT F sans point. Fleur de Coin. (kingdom of Belgium, Leopold I, 1831-65, copper two centimes of 1845, no dot in engraver's signature. Uncirculated.)"

This type was struck 1833-65 in large quantities but most dates before 1845 are scarce in nice condition.

Recorded mintage: 8,324,000, a common date.

Specification: copper, 3.6 g.

Catalog reference: KM 4.2, Dupriez 222.
